Originally Posted by tmntgeoff View Post
I went to the Seattle mopop museum which had the Henson exhibit and there wasn't 1 thing about the turtles. I wondered why since at the time it was there most technically advanced puppets, but that would probably explain why there was nothing there. Makes me wonder why they even did the suits for the 2nd movie if they were so displeased with the turtles.

The only reason he agreed to do them in the first place was because of Steve Barron and he wasnt even the director for soto
That's kind of a bummer honestly...not going to lie I'm a little miffed they didn't put the Turtles in the exhibit (that I just found out about)
